Output fe96460dc113a320f7f2a67b04a29afccd5e604e8af0d22a561bc13809c20b7f:2

value
19646756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76be7cd2bb377f8f931a9a41681c3adb48f8c362 OP_EQUAL
address
3CWsrVM97KUm36cqGVVSJadvKeBSmv8tbt
transaction
fe96460dc113a320f7f2a67b04a29afccd5e604e8af0d22a561bc13809c20b7f
spent
true